ABOUT: BLOODHOUND DOG BREED
The bloodhound is a large scent hound known for its exceptional tracking abilities. With a distinctive wrinkled face and droopy ears, these dogs have a keen sense of smell, second only to the beagle. Bloodhounds are gentle, affectionate, and good with children, making them excellent family pets. Their determination and relentless tracking skills have made them invaluable in search and rescue missions. Regular exercise and mental stimulation are essential to keep these intelligent dogs happy and healthy.
The boxer is a medium to large sized dog breed known for its muscular build, distinctive square head, and energetic personality. Boxers are loyal, affectionate, and good natured companions, making them an ideal family pet. They are intelligent, playful, and love to be around people, making them excellent with children. Boxers require consistent training, plenty of exercise, and socialization to thrive. With their strong work ethic and protective instincts, boxers excel in various roles, including as service dogs, therapy dogs, and in dog sports.
